Schedule for Evolution Earth

The Universe

The Universe

New discoveries are creating a fundamental rethinking of our solar system.

2025-12-27 05:00:01 +0000 UTC2025-12-27 05:50:41 +0000 UTC (50m)
Previous Next
Previous Next